Summary for Patent: 5,656,286
| Title: | Solubility parameter based drug delivery system and method for altering drug saturation concentration |
| Abstract: | A blend of at least two polymers, or at least one polymer and a soluble polyvinylpyrrolidone, in combination with a drug provides a pressure-sensitive adhesive composition for a transdermal drug delivery system in which the drug is delivered from the pressure-sensitive adhesive composition and through dermis when the pressure-sensitive adhesive composition is in contact with human skin. According to the invention, soluble polyvinylpyrrolidone can be used to prevent crystallization of the drug, without affecting the rate of drug delivery from the pressure-sensitive adhesive composition. |
| Inventor(s): | Jesus Miranda, Steven Sablotsky |
| Assignee: | Noven Pharmaceuticals Inc |
| Application Number: | US08/178,558 |

FAQs1) Does claim 1 require a specific drug?No. Claim 1 recites “one drug or a mixture of two or more drugs,” and dependent claims then enumerate drug classes and examples. 2) What is the fixed PVP requirement?Across claim 1 and the claim 4 branch, soluble PVP must be present at about 1% to about 20% by weight of the total pressure-sensitive adhesive composition (dependent claims specify molecular weight bands). 3) What adhesive polymers are mandatory in the PSA blend?The PSA blend is defined as including (i) a PSA polymer selected from a listed group at 14% to 94%, (ii) polyisobutylene at 10% to 90%, and (iii) polysiloxane at 5% to 95%. 4) How does claim 4 differ from claim 1?Claim 4 adds polyacrylate (5% to 85%) and a constraint that the solubility parameter difference between polyacrylate and the base PSA (a) is at least 2 (J/cm³)^(1/2), while still requiring soluble PVP and drug plus optional enhancer. 5) Do the device-layer claims create standalone infringement risk?They do not appear standalone in this claim set. Backing, release liner, and reservoir architecture are dependent to the composition-focused claim framework, so infringement still requires meeting the adhesive/PVP composition elements.
